/**
* Class to index surrogates mapping (surface form -> set of resources) in lucene.
* This does not index context (paragraphs around an entity mention). For that see @link{org.dbpedia.spotlight.index.OccurrenceContextIndexer}
* @author pablomendes
* @author maxjakob
*/
public class CandidateIndexer extends BaseIndexer<Candidate> {
final static Log LOG = LogFactory.getLog(BaseIndexer.class);
/**
* Constructs a surrogate indexer that follows the policy specified by the {@link org.dbpedia.spotlight.lucene.LuceneManager} implementation used.
* @param indexManager For a caseInsensitive behavior, use {@link org.dbpedia.spotlight.lucene.LuceneManager.CaseInsensitiveSurfaceForms}.
* @throws java.io.IOException
*/
public CandidateIndexer(LuceneManager indexManager) throws IOException {
super(indexManager);
}
public void add(SurfaceForm surfaceForm, DBpediaResource resource) throws IndexException {
Document newDoc = mLucene.createDocument(surfaceForm, resource);
try {
mWriter.addDocument(newDoc); // do not commit for faster indexing.
} catch (IOException e) {
throw new IndexException("Error adding candidate map to the index. ", e);
}
LOG.trace("Added to " + mLucene.directory().toString() + ": " + surfaceForm.toString() + " -> " + resource.toString());
}
public void add(List<SurfaceForm> surfaceForms, DBpediaResource resource) throws IndexException {
Document newDoc = mLucene.createDocument(surfaceForms.get(0), resource);
for (int i=1; i<surfaceForms.size(); i++) {
newDoc.add(mLucene.getField(surfaceForms.get(i)));
}
try {
mWriter.addDocument(newDoc); // do not commit for faster indexing.
} catch (IOException e) {
throw new IndexException("Error adding candidate map to the index. ", e);
}
LOG.trace("Added to " + mLucene.directory().toString() + ": " + surfaceForms.toString() + " -> " + resource.toString());
}
public void add(SurfaceForm surfaceForm, DBpediaResource resource, int nTimes) throws IndexException {
Document newDoc = mLucene.createDocument(surfaceForm, resource, nTimes);
try {
mWriter.addDocument(newDoc); //TODO ATTENTION need to merge with existing doc if URI is already in index
} catch (IOException e) {
throw new IndexException("Error adding candidate map to the index. ", e);
}
LOG.trace("Added to " + mLucene.directory().toString() + ": " + surfaceForm.toString() + " -> " + resource.toString());
}
public void add(Candidate candidate) throws IndexException {
add(candidate.surfaceForm(), candidate.resource());
}
/**
* Index surrogates mapping from a triples file.
*/
public void addFromNTfile(File surfaceFormsDataSet) throws IOException, IndexException {
LOG.info("Indexing candidate map from "+surfaceFormsDataSet.getName()+" to "+mLucene.directory()+"...");
NxParser nxParser = new NxParser(new FileInputStream(surfaceFormsDataSet), false);
while (nxParser.hasNext()) {
Node[] nodes = nxParser.next();
String resourceString = nodes[0].toString().replace(SpotlightConfiguration.DEFAULT_NAMESPACE,"");
String surfaceFormString = nodes[2].toString();
List<SurfaceForm> surfaceForms = AddSurfaceFormsToIndex.fromTitlesToAlternativesJ(new SurfaceForm(surfaceFormString));
add(surfaceForms, new DBpediaResource(resourceString));
}
LOG.info("Done.");
}
/**
* Index surrogates mapping from a tab separated file.
*/
public void addFromTSVfile(File surfaceFormsDataSet) throws IOException, IndexException {
LOG.info("Indexing candidate map from "+surfaceFormsDataSet.getName()+" to "+mLucene.directory()+"...");
String separator = "\t";
Scanner tsvScanner = new Scanner(new FileInputStream(surfaceFormsDataSet), "UTF-8");
while(tsvScanner.hasNextLine()) {
String[] line = tsvScanner.nextLine().split(separator);
String surfaceFormString = line[0];
String resourceString = line[1];
//TODO read counts and set DBpediaResource.support
// int countSfRes = new Integer(line[2])
DBpediaResource res = new DBpediaResource(resourceString);
// DBpediaResource res = new DBpediaResource(resourceString,countSfRes)
List<SurfaceForm> surfaceForms = AddSurfaceFormsToIndex.fromTitlesToAlternativesJ(new SurfaceForm(surfaceFormString));
add(surfaceForms, res);
}
LOG.info("Done.");
}
